s390/sclp: store the increment_size in the sclp device
Let's calculate it once and reuse it. Suggested-by: Matthew Rosato <mjrosato@linux.vnet.ibm.com> Reviewed-by: Matthew Rosato <mjrosato@linux.vnet.ibm.com> Signed-off-by: David Hildenbrand <dahi@linux.vnet.ibm.com> Signed-off-by: Cornelia Huck <cornelia.huck@de.ibm.com>
